Appraisal Institute of Canada, Introduction to Professional Practice Course

The Appraisal Institute of Canada’s (AIC) Introduction to Professional Practice (ITPP) course is a requirement for those individuals interested in becoming a Candidate Member of Appraisal Institute of Canada (AIC). The course is a requirement for both the CRA and AACI designations.

The course is designed and presented by designated AIC members and is delivered through UBC’s distance learning platform. Students may begin the course at any time and proceed at their own pace, providing they complete the course within one year of registration.

AIC Introduction to professional Practice

Course Components

The course is divided into five modules:

  • Module 1: Introduction to CUSPAP
  • Module 2: Ethics and Conduct
  • Module 3: Practice Standards
  • Module 4: Regulations and Policies
  • Module 5: Insurance

Students must complete Module 1 first, then may complete the other modules in their order of preference.

Quizzes

To successfully finish the course, participants will need to complete a quiz at the end of each module achieving a passing grade of 60% or higher, within one year of registering in the course. If a grade of 60% is not achieved on any quiz, the participant must rewrite the quiz before proceeding. A $25 fee applies per rewrite attempt.

Once participants have successfully completed all of the modules and quizzes, proof of competition is automatically uploaded to the Appraisal Institute of Canada’s database provided you entered your AIC member number during registration.

Non-AIC Students

Other valuation organizations may recognize the ITPP course as a demonstration of Canadian valuation standards for designation or workplace purposes. The International Association of Assessing Officers (IAAO) accepts the ITPP course for Canadian residents as meeting the appraisal standards requirement for IAAO designations. Note that IAAO members seeking recertification are recommended to instead register in the Professional Practice Seminar (PPS). Non-AIC students wishing to register in ITPP must first obtain an AIC membership number, as this is required for the course’s administration (please note this AIC membership number is required only for registration purposes, this does not require students to qualify for membership in AIC).
